Zoning ordinances create the broad, general framework for a community; the comprehensive
plan defines the details and implements the ordinances. - correct answer ✔✔ The answer is
false. A comprehensive plan creates the broad, general framework for a community; zoning
ordinances define the details and implement the plan.
Bulk zoning ensures that certain types of uses are incorporated into developments. - correct
answer ✔✔ The answer is false. Incentive zoning ensures that certain types of uses are
incorporated into developments.
No uniform planning and land development legislation affects the entire country. - correct
answer ✔✔ The answer is true. Laws governing subdividing and land planning are controlled by
state and local governing bodies where the land is located.
One negative aspect of subdivision development is the potential for increased tax burdens. -
correct answer ✔✔ The answer is true. To protect local taxpayers, many local governments
strictly regulate subdivision development and may impose impact fees.
A conditional-use permit allows a landowner to use property in a way that is not ordinarily
permitted by zoning, due to unusual hardship or deprivation of reasonable use by the
regulation. - correct answer ✔✔ The answer is false. A variance provides relief if zoning
regulations deprive an owner of the reasonable use of the property.
Zoning permits are usually required before building permits can be issued. - correct answer ✔✔
The answer is true. Typically, a zoning permit is required before building permits are issued; the
building permit allows municipal officials to be aware of new construction or alterations and can
verify compliance with building codes and zoning ordinances.
